.elementor-337 .elementor-element.elementor-element-68c7e2ee{--display:flex;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--background-transition:0.3s;--padding-block-start:260px;--padding-block-end:140px;--padding-inline-start:0px;--padding-inline-end:0px;}.elementor-337 .elementor-element.elementor-element-68c7e2ee:not(.elementor-motion-effects-element-type-background), .elementor-337 .elementor-element.elementor-element-68c7e2ee >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-primary );}.elementor-337 .elementor-element.elementor-element-68c7e2ee, .elementor-337 .elementor-element.elementor-element-68c7e2ee::before{--border-transition:0.3s;}.elementor-337 .elementor-element.elementor-element-e8e53de{text-align:center;}.elementor-337 .elementor-element.elementor-element-e8e53de .elementor-heading-title{color:var( --e-global-color-5b60c7d );font-family:var( --e-global-typography-5ad7db5-font-family ), Sans-serif;font-size:var( --e-global-typography-5ad7db5-font-size );font-weight:var( --e-global-typography-5ad7db5-font-weight );text-transform:var( --e-global-typography-5ad7db5-text-transform );font-style:var( --e-global-typography-5ad7db5-font-style );text-decoration:var( --e-global-typography-5ad7db5-text-decoration );line-height:var( --e-global-typography-5ad7db5-line-height );letter-spacing:var( --e-global-typography-5ad7db5-letter-spacing );word-spacing:var( --e-global-typography-5ad7db5-word-spacing );}.elementor-337 .elementor-element.elementor-element-1452390{text-align:center;color:var( --e-global-color-f374896 );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);text-transform:var( --e-global-typography-text-text-transform );font-style:var( --e-global-typography-text-font-style );text-decoration:var( --e-global-typography-text-text-decoration );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);width:var( --container-widget-width, 524px );max-width:524px;--container-widget-width:524px;--container-widget-flex-grow:0;}.elementor-337 .elementor-element.elementor-element-1452390 > .elementor-widget-container{margin:10px 0px 0px 0px;}.elementor-337 .elementor-element.elementor-element-0bf53ae >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 10px 0px 10px;background-color:var( --e-global-color-5b60c7d );}.elementor-337 .elementor-element.elementor-element-0bf53ae.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-337 .elementor-element.elementor-element-0bf53ae{z-index:9;}.elementor-337 .elementor-element.elementor-element-23e0f854{--display:flex;--background-transition:0.3s;}.elementor-337 .elementor-element.elementor-element-42e5e99c{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--align-items:center;--gap:40px 40px;--flex-wrap:wrap;--background-transition:0.3s;--padding-block-start:140px;--padding-block-end:140px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-79c34b94{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--background-transition:0.3s;--padding-block-start:10px;--padding-block-end:10px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-3d062a2{--grid-columns:3;}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ination{text-align:center;font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-size:var( --e-global-typography-accent-font-size );font-weight:var( --e-global-typography-accent-font-weight );text-transform:var( --e-global-typography-accent-text-transform );font-style:var( --e-global-typography-accent-font-style );text-decoration:var( --e-global-typography-accent-text-decoration );line-height:var( --e-global-typography-accent-line-height );letter-spacing:var( --e-global-typography-accent-letter-spacing );margin-top:21px;}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ers:not(.dots){color:var( --e-global-color-primary );}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ination a.page-numbers:hover{color:var( --e-global-color-accent );}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ers.current{color:var( --e-global-color-accent );}body:not(.rtl) .el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ers:not(:first-child){margin-left:calc( 10px/2 );}body:not(.rtl) .el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ers:not(:last-child){margin-right:calc( 10px/2 );}body.rtl .el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ers:not(:first-child){margin-right:calc( 10px/2 );}body.rtl .el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ination .page-numbers:not(:last-child){margin-left:calc( 10px/2 );}@media(max-width:1024px){.elementor-337 .elementor-element.elementor-element-68c7e2ee{--padding-block-start:260px;--padding-block-end:120px;--padding-inline-start:20px;--padding-inline-end:20px;}.elementor-337 .elementor-element.elementor-element-e8e53de .elementor-heading-title{font-size:var( --e-global-typography-5ad7db5-font-size );line-height:var( --e-global-typography-5ad7db5-line-height );letter-spacing:var( --e-global-typography-5ad7db5-letter-spacing );word-spacing:var( --e-global-typography-5ad7db5-word-spacing );}.elementor-337 .elementor-element.elementor-element-1452390{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-337 .elementor-element.elementor-element-0bf53ae >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-337 .elementor-element.elementor-element-42e5e99c{--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--gap:0px 0px;--padding-block-start:100px;--padding-block-end:100px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-79c34b94{--padding-block-start:10px;--padding-block-end:10px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-3d062a2{--grid-columns:2;}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);letter-spacing:var( --e-global-typography-accent-letter-spacing );}}@media(max-width:767px){.elementor-337 .elementor-element.elementor-element-68c7e2ee{--padding-block-start:140px;--padding-block-end:80px;--padding-inline-start:20px;--padding-inline-end:20px;}.elementor-337 .elementor-element.elementor-element-e8e53de .elementor-heading-title{font-size:var( --e-global-typography-5ad7db5-font-size );line-height:var( --e-global-typography-5ad7db5-line-height );letter-spacing:var( --e-global-typography-5ad7db5-letter-spacing );word-spacing:var( --e-global-typography-5ad7db5-word-spacing );}.elementor-337 .elementor-element.elementor-element-1452390{text-align:left;font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);width:100%;max-width:100%;}.elementor-337 .elementor-element.elementor-element-1452390 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-337 .elementor-element.elementor-element-42e5e99c{--padding-block-start:60px;--padding-block-end:60px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-79c34b94{--padding-block-start:10px;--padding-block-end:10px;--padding-inline-start:10px;--padding-inline-end:10px;}.elementor-337 .elementor-element.elementor-element-3d062a2{--grid-columns:1;}.elementor-337 .elementor-element.elementor-element-3d062a2 .elementor-pagination{font-size:var( --e-global-typography-accent-font-size );line-height:var( --e-global-typography-accent-line-height );letter-spacing:var( --e-global-typography-accent-letter-spacing );}}@media(min-width:768px){.elementor-337 .elementor-element.elementor-element-68c7e2ee{--content-width:1290px;}.elementor-337 .elementor-element.elementor-element-23e0f854{--content-width:500px;}.elementor-337 .elementor-element.elementor-element-42e5e99c{--content-width:1290px;}.elementor-337 .elementor-element.elementor-element-79c34b94{--width:100%;}}@media(max-width:1024px) and (min-width:768px){.elementor-337 .elementor-element.elementor-element-79c34b94{--width:100%;}}/* Start custom CSS for wpforms, class: .elementor-element-0bf53ae */.wpforms-form {
    display: flex;
    flex-wrap: wrap;
}
/*content*/
.wpforms-field-container {
    flex: 0 0 75%;
}
.wpforms-field-container label{
    font-size: 18px !important;
    font-weight: 400 !important;
}
 #wpforms-192-field_2, #wpforms-192-field_1{
    border-radius: 0;
    border-color: #03162C40 !important;
    border: 0px;
    border-bottom: 1px solid ;
}
/*select*/
.wpforms-field-container select#wpforms-192-field_3{
    border-radius: 0;
    border-color: #03162C40 !important;
    border:0 !important;
    border-bottom: 1px solid #03162C40 !important;
}
.wpforms-field-container select#wpforms-192-field_3:focus{
    box-shadow:none;
}
#wpforms-form-192 ::-webkit-input-placeholder { /* WebKit browsers */
    font-family: Inter, sans-serif;
    font-size: 16px;
    font-weight: 300;
}

#wpforms-form-192 :-moz-placeholder { /* Mozilla Firefox 4 to 18 */
    font-family: Inter, sans-serif;
    font-size: 16px;
    font-weight: 300;
}

#wpforms-form-192 ::-moz-placeholder { /* Mozilla Firefox 19+ */
    font-family: Inter, sans-serif;
    font-size: 16px;
    font-weight: 300;
}

#wpforms-form-192 :-ms-input-placeholder { /* Internet Explorer 10+ */
    font-family: Inter, sans-serif;
    font-size: 16px;
    font-weight: 300;
}

#wpforms-form-192 ::placeholder { /* Recent browsers */
    font-family: Inter, sans-serif;
    font-size: 16px;
    font-weight: 300;
}

.wpforms-field-container input::placeholder {
    color: #999;
    font-family: Oswald !important;
    font-size: 16px !important;
}
#wpforms-192-field_3{
    color: #999;
    font-weight: 300;
    font-family: Oswald !important;
    font-size: 16px !important;
}
/*button*/
.wpforms-submit-container {
    flex: 0 0 25%;
        display: flex;
    align-items: center;
}

#wpforms-submit-192 {
    width: 85% ;
    margin-left: auto;
    height: 58px;
    font-family: Oswald;
    border-radius: 0 !Important;
    background: #ffd636;
    color: #03162c;
    font-size: 18px;
    box-shadow: none !important;
}
#wpforms-submit-192:hover{
    background: #03162c;
    color: #fff;
}


/*shi'pei适配 */
/* 平板端适配 */
@media (max-width: 1024px) {
    .wpforms-form {
        flex-wrap: wrap;
    }

    .wpforms-field-container {
        flex: 0 0 100%;
    }

    .wpforms-submit-container {
        flex: 0 0 100%;
        margin-top: 20px; /* 可以根据需要调整按钮与表单的垂直间距 */
    }
    #wpforms-submit-192 {
    width: 100% ;}
}

/* 手机端适配 */
@media (max-width: 768px) {
    .wpforms-field-container {
        flex: 0 0 100%;
    }
.wpforms-field-container input,.wpforms-field-container  select{
    display:block;
}
.wpforms-field-container .wpforms-one-third{
    width:100% !important;
    margin-left:0px !important;
}
    .wpforms-submit-container {
        flex: 0 0 100%;
        margin-top: 20px; /* 可以根据需要调整按钮与表单的垂直间距 */
    }
    #wpforms-submit-192 {
    width: 100% ;}
}/* End custom CSS */